ARDMORE, Okla. – Oklahoma women's golf finished The Bruzzy on Sunday at Dornick Hills Country Club, tying for fifth (35-over, 875).
Junior
Reagan Chaney entered the final 18 tied for first and finished the two-day tournament tied for fourth (2-over, 212), shooting a 5-over 75 to conclude the event. Chaney tallied three bogeys in her first four holes and responded with back-to-back birdies on the sixth and seventh holes. The Ardmore, Okla., product fired a 1-over 35 on the front nine and finished the back nine 4-over 40.
Sophomore
Gracie Mayo tied for 27th (12-over, 222) and recorded the best round by a Sooner on Sunday, finishing 2-over 72. Mayo opened the final round with a bogey on the sixth and eighth holes before her first birdie on the 11th hole. She suffered a one-stroke setback on the 15th and 18th holes, wrapping up the back nine 1-over 37. Mayo concluded the round with three pars and a birdie on the par-4 third hole.
